We will need writeback_range() to implement S3 suspend properly on K8,
GeodeLX and Qemu. C7 and Core2 are not affected.
Either way, writeback_range() is a good thing to have, so start
implementing it on K8.
I uncovered a bug in the AMD manuals. That bug is annotated in the code
as well to make sure nobody wants to "fix" this code.

Compile tested on DBM690T and Qemu.

 /**
+ * This function is processor specific.
+ */
+void writeback_range(unsigned long start, unsigned long len)
+{
+       unsigned long cachelinesize, i;
+       /* Number of quadwords flushed by CLFLUSH in bit 8..15
+        * NOTE: The AMD64 Architecture Programmer's Manual Volume 3 rev 3.14
+        * CLFLUSH section contradicts the AMD CPUID Specification rev 2.28
+        * about where to find CLFLUSH size.
+        * I'm using the CPUID spec definition.
+        */
+       cachelinesize = (cpuid_ebx(0x00000001) & 0xff00) >> 8;
+       /* Convert quadwords to bytes */
+       cachelinesize <<= 3;
+       /* MFENCE before and after CLFLUSH is needed according to
+        * AMD64 Architecture Programmer's Manual Volume 3: CLFLUSH
+        */
+       __asm__ volatile ("mfence");
+       for (i = start; i < start + len; i += cachelinesize) {
+               __asm__ volatile (
+                       "clflush (%0)   \n"
+                       ::"a" (i));
+       }
+       __asm__ volatile ("mfence");
+}
